Systematic Investigation Of The Erigeron Breviscapus Mechanism For Treating Cerebrovascular Diseases

Cerebrovascular diseases(CBVDs),characterized by striking morbidity and mortality,have become one of the most threatening diseases for human beings,which are arousing more and more attention.The existing drugs of CBVDs target one or few pathogenic factors,which the efficacy is limited because of the complexity of diseases.Traditional Chinese medicine(TCM),featured by multi-component and multi-target endow the great effectiveness in CBVDs treatment.For instance,Erigeron breviscapus,Aster breviscapus Vant,has been used to treat CBVDs for long time and the efficacy has been verified through years' of practice.Nevertheless,the mechanisms of Erigeron breviscapus to treat the CBVDs are still unclear.To systematically decipher the Erigeron breviscapus mechanisms for CBVDs,the systems pharmacology approach is utilized by ADME pharmacokinetic screen,target fishing,and network analysis.Main results for this study are as follows:(1).First,14 potentially active molecules are screened out through in silico ADME pharmacokinetic evaluation,most of which have been reported with excellent biological activities.(2).Then 169 targets of active molecules are read out using our in-house software systems drug targeting(sys DT)and Weighted Ensemble Similarity(WES).(3).We find that component targets are significantly enriched to the CBVDs therapeutic targets by analyzing their biological processes and protein-protein interaction(PPI).(4).A multi-layer network analysis method including components-targets network,targets-pathways network and “CBVDs pathway” indicates the Erigeron breviscapus exerts protective effect on CBVDs via regulating multiple pathways and hitting on multiple targets.(5).Meanwhile in vitro experiments confirm that the stigmasterol,scutellarein and daucosterol from Erigeron breviscapus can treat CBVDs by increasing the MEK and PLC? proteins levels as well as decreasing the expression of Bax,PI3 K and eNOS,which led to the cell survival,proliferation and contraction.The approach used in this work offers a new exemplification for systematically understanding the mechanisms of herb medicine,which will give an impulse to the CBVDs drug development.
